IT Outsourcing Trends for 2023

Outsourcing Information Technology: Outsourced IT services pertain to the external provision of design, implementation, upkeep, and modernisation of a company’s software and hardware systems. This may extend to on-site and remote support, and is executed for sundry reasons, such as reinforcing the existing IT team or serving as a complete replacement of the IT department.

Enterprises can reap several advantages from such services, like decreased expenditure, enhanced productivity, simplified operations and heightened security. How Your Business Can Profit by Outsourcing IT

Outlined below are a few advantages that assist IT departments and overall businesses in accomplishing their goals.

Reducing expenditure. Various IT outsourcing services have subscription schemes, enabling businesses to plan their finances more precisely. Additionally, recruitment can be minimised or optimised, leading to cost-cutting. Outsourced IT vendors usually have their separate rules and processes for engaging and directing IT experts, along with their remuneration, time off, and growth opportunities.

Mastery. Enterprises that outsource their IT operations can avail of various areas of expertise in diverse industries and domains. This furnishes team members with the prospect of acquiring a comprehensive comprehension of prevalent predicaments and complexities. By exchanging and disseminating information on state-of-the-art technological progressions, they can guarantee that these advancements are implemented effectually. Consequently, any IT issues that you may encounter can be resolved expeditiously and with efficacy.

Swiftness. If you solely depend on in-house resources for IT support, it may be vital to defer significant projects. Outsourcing IT might permit the project to commence at once, as outsourced teams have extensive deployment abilities and are capable of operationalising your product without any delay.

Concentration. In situations where your team needs to apply itself to strategic initiatives, such as resolving intricate business issues, it can be advantageous to complement your in-house IT department with external IT specialists. It can also be beneficial if your IT department lacks the necessary know-how to contend with certain assignments. Availing of external IT assistance is an efficient approach to augmenting your current team.

Safety. It is probable that not all members of your company’s IT department have obtained adequate security training. Therefore, it is prudent to seek assistance from an outsourced IT firm that employs experts who are well-versed in security regulations and their effective implementation. Attempting to manage security on your own is not advisable, as it is crucial for any enterprise to keep itself abreast of the latest security measures.

Possible Drawbacks of Enlisting an External Company to Deal with Your Enterprise’s IT

While assessing the feasibility of outsourcing IT, it is crucial for business leaders to carefully evaluate the pros and cons involved. Despite the numerous advantages of outsourcing IT, there are also likely pitfalls that must be factored in before determining whether it is a suitable option for the enterprise. Instances of these downsides encompass:

Reduced control. When enlisting an external provider for IT services, it is crucial to have faith in their ability to execute directions in a precise and meticulous manner, even with lesser detail than what would be provided internally. This can be a challenging juncture to navigate due to the crucial and delicate nature of such tasks, which necessitates IT managers to be willing to surrender some of their power and influence to ensure a successful cooperation.

Possible quality decline. Despite our best expectations while collaborating with an outsourced IT provider, there is a likelihood that they may not meet our standards. Discovering a new supplier and remedying any errors made by the prior one will demand substantial exertions and assets.

Difficulties in transmitting concepts and data. When evaluating the possibility of outsourcing IT assignments to an external provider, cost savings may be notable when compared to domestic service providers. Nevertheless, obstacles in communication such as variances in time zones, language barriers, and cultural distinctions may pose challenges. To ensure that the team is capable of collaboratively functioning, it is crucial to seek out a supplier in a similar time zone who has prior experience in working with multinational teams. Attention should also be given to language abilities to help alleviate potential misinterpretations.

Exposure to risk in terms of security. Owing to the ambiguous nature of security, it has been considered both an advantage and a disadvantage. Although IT personnel employed by outsourced businesses are frequently adept in security procedures, there is still potential for risk. It is feasible that the security mechanisms enforced by an external firm may not be as impenetrable as the ones employed internally, thereby rending the organisation susceptible to unauthorised access.

Utmost contentment amidst the workforce. In the outsourcing sector, there exist companies that place a greater emphasis on the well-being of their contracted employees compared to others. Neglecting to guarantee job fulfilment may lead to a drop in productivity, akin to any other form of enterprise. Although it may be arduous to directly influence the contentment of outsourced IT personnel, it is crucial to acknowledge the effect that this can have on their productivity.

Recent Developments in IT Outsourcing

The COVID-19 pandemic has brought about two major changes that have bolstered the demand for IT services, consequently augmenting IT outsourcing. Firstly, several businesses have transformed their operational procedures to favour digital means, such as employing apps and cloud services for compiling and exchanging data. Secondly, there has been a palpable surge in cyberattacks with regard to both frequency and severity.

New studies have revealed that 87% of worldwide IT decision makers anticipate that the COVID-19 pandemic will expedite the shift of enterprises to the cloud. Professionals in the industry estimate that this transition will reach completion by 2025, with 95% of all workloads being accommodated in the cloud. Moreover, according to a report published on CNET, 2023 marked a historic high in the occurrence of security breaches.

Outsourcing IT services is a dependable approach to stay abreast of industry patterns. Outsourcing firms can aid businesses in developing, executing and overseeing digital technology solutions that can refine operations and augment both employee efficiency and communication.

Outsourcing suppliers are consistently financing the technologies required to safeguard businesses from cyber assaults, for instance VPNs, SSLs, and multifactor authentication. As per experts in the industry, expenditure on information security is anticipated to be in the hundreds of billions of dollars annually on a worldwide scale.

The offering of bespoke software solutions has emerged as a priority for internal IT teams, resulting in an uptick in IT outsourcing. Such applications can boost productivity and facilitate customised processes; nevertheless, businesses often invest ample resources in their creation. Accordingly, more corporations are choosing to enlist externalsoftware developersto construct these applications, enabling internal IT departments to concentrate on operational chores and strategic planning.

Predictions for the Global Information Technology Services Industry in 2023

Mordor Intelligence LLP has forecasted that the global IT outsourcing industry will amass a value of $682.3 billion by 2027, a surge from its monetary worth of $526.6 billion in 2023. This reflects an escalated craving for IT outsourcing services across the world.

In reaction to the varying requirements of IT departments, in certain instances, outsourcing service providers are supplanting the Service Level Agreement (SLA) model and offering more than just Key Performance Indicator (KPI) conformance. This transformation has engendered the concept of an Experience Level Agreement (XLA), which considers not only the operative efficiency of back-end systems but also the user experience and productivity enhancements realised through the application of new technology. The Comprehensive Guide to Choosing the Perfect Information Technology Outsourcing Company for Your Enterprise

Once the decision to pursue outsourcing has been made, it is vital to initiate the process of investigating a dependable outsourcing company as soon as possible. To ensure the selection of the most suitable provider, it is crucial to compile a list of the essential attributes and services that the provider must offer. Decision-makers should deliberate on queries such as, “Which dilemmas do we require a resolution for?” “What aspects of service providers carry the greatest significance for us and why?”, and “What is our budget for this?”

Solicit feedback from your colleagues on external service providers they have had satisfactory encounters with. Collate a roster of prospective suppliers that comprises their contact information, area of expertise, and any other pertinent particulars. Additionally, perform an internet search for vendors that align with your criteria, for example, location (if applicable), cost, and specialisation. Append any intriguing outcomes to your list.

Undertaking online searches is an efficacious avenue of discovering fitting providers for the subjects you require assistance with. For instance, if you aspire to construct your own content management system, conducting a search for “IT outsourcing provider” or “software development business” may furnish a variety of blog outcomes. By evaluating the calibre of these blog entries and other resources accessible, you can competently evaluate a company’s proficiency in the domain.

Online marketplaces, such as Clutch, can aid in the quest of discovering potential suppliers by permitting a comparison of factors such as geographical location, customer ratings, and specialised services. When compiling a list, all conceivable service providers should be taken into account.

To refine your options, scrutinising each service provider’s website is imperative. Diligently evaluate any attributes that look either exceedingly advantageous or probably problematic. It is plausible that the vendor does not offer the service you necessitate; therefore, it is recommended to reach out to them to obtain confirmation, even if they appear to be well-suited otherwise. If this scenario transpires, it is expected to be a determining element.

When making a decision, it is advantageous to take into consideration non-technical aspects, such as the level of service that can be anticipated, the process for selecting engineers, and the terms of the agreement that will be presented.

After you have reduced the list of potential suppliers to three to five, schedule meetings to explore their offerings. Urge them to exhibit their product and do not be reluctant to ask any queries you may have. After the meetings, you will be competent enough to make an enlightened decision and continue with the business association.
